西门子PLC 200smart伺服电机三轴等分画圆技术
需积分: 28 13 浏览量
更新于2024-10-20
2
收藏 47KB ZIP 举报
资源摘要信息: "西门子200smart伺服电机三轴画圆.zip"
在工业自动化领域,西门子PLC(Programmable Logic Controller)是一个广泛使用的控制系统,其中西门子smart200系列PLC适合于中小型自动化应用。伺服电机是一种高精度的运动执行元件,能够精确地控制位置、速度和加速度,广泛应用于需要精确运动控制的场合,例如在机器人、精密定位平台等设备中。伺服电机通常需要通过PLC或者其他运动控制器来实现精确控制。
三轴画圆是指在一个三维空间中,利用三个相互垂直的运动轴来实现圆周运动或绘制圆形轨迹。这种技术在很多制造和自动化领域中是非常常见的,如数控机床的铣削、3D打印机的打印头运动、以及各种自动化装配线中的物料搬运等。
通常,画圆可以通过逼近法实现,也就是通过将圆形分割成许多小直线段来近似圆形。每一段直线与相邻直线形成的角度很小,对于观察者而言,多个小直线连接起来就形成了一个平滑的圆形。然而,这种方法在某些高精度要求的场合下可能不够精确,或者在高速运动时会因为速度不均匀造成圆弧不够平滑。
等分画圆的方法是指将一个圆周等分为若干份,每个等分点都作为圆周上的一点,通过控制伺服电机的运动使得每一点都能够精确到达,从而实现更加平滑和精确的圆形轨迹。这种方法相较于逼近法,在某些高精度要求的应用中会得到更好的效果。
通过使用西门子smart200系列PLC对伺服电机进行控制,可以实现更加复杂的运动控制任务。PLC通过高速的指令处理能力和丰富的运动控制指令库来实现对伺服电机的精确控制。在西门子smart200系列PLC的软件编程环境中,工程师可以利用其提供的运动控制指令来编写程序,实现对伺服电机的三轴画圆控制。
在本次提供的文件中,"西门子200smart伺服电机三轴画圆.zip",包含了一个压缩包,里面包含了若干文件,这些文件可能包括了用于实现三轴画圆控制逻辑的程序代码。文件名称列表中的“伺服电机三轴画圆”直接暗示了压缩包内容与三轴画圆控制程序相关。工程师在使用这些文件时需要有西门子smart200系列PLC的相关知识,了解其编程软件的使用方法,并具备伺服电机控制的基础知识。
为了实现三轴画圆控制,工程师需要进行以下几步工作:
1. 设计控制逻辑:首先需要根据具体的机械结构和应用需求来设计伺服电机的运动控制逻辑,包括确定运动的起始点、终点、速度、加速度等参数。
2. 编写PLC程序:利用西门子smart200系列PLC的编程软件编写控制程序,将设计好的控制逻辑转化为PLC可以执行的程序代码。
3. 参数配置:在PLC程序中对伺服驱动器的参数进行配置,包括电机类型、编码器类型、速度和位置参数等。
4. 测试与调试:将编写好的程序下载到PLC中,并进行实际的测试。调试过程中可能需要反复修改程序和参数,直到伺服电机能够精确地按照预定轨迹进行画圆运动。
通过以上步骤,可以实现一个精确的三轴伺服电机画圆控制程序,从而在实际应用中提高产品的加工精度和生产效率。
2019-10-29 上传
2019-09-17 上传
2023-09-15 上传
2019-10-22 上传
133 浏览量
汪叶
- 粉丝: 0
- 资源: 2
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用